A typical post picks up 2.7K interactions against 664K followers, an engagement rate of 0.4%. Measured over 22 original posts, its engagement rate beats 90% of 3,758 tracked accounts of a similar size. Comparing inside a size band matters here: engagement rate falls as accounts grow, so a raw rate would mostly just re-measure the follower count. Posts are seen about 42K times each, and 6.34% of those impressions turn into an interaction. That is about 6.31% of the follower count, which is the gap between an audience on paper and an audience in a timeline. Posting runs at about 0.77 post a day over the last 30 days, with activity on roughly 60% of days. Most posts go out around 09:00 UTC, and Monday is the busiest day of the week. Of the 22 posts sampled, 73% carry an image or video. The account's strongest tracked post pulled 7.2K interactions, about 2.7x its own typical post. Compared with accounts its own size

Le frasi di Osho's engagement rate beats 90% of the tracked X accounts closest to it in follower count (3,758 accounts, accounts of similar size (decile 8 of 10)). A percentile is spread evenly by construction, so 50 really is the middle of that group and 90 really is its top tenth.

On engagement per impression rather than per follower it beats 95% of the same group. When those two numbers disagree, the gap is about how far its posts travel rather than how people react to them.
